Altcoin Ethereum emerges as leading blockchain

One of the leading names in the crypto community, Mr. Huber sparked a Twitter conversation by reviewing the 2018 report of the Chinese Ministry of Truth, with a surprising explanation. The report was published by the CCID Research Institute of the Ministry of Industry and Information Technologies. Accordingly, it introduces the Global Public Blockchain Technology Assessment Index. This index evaluates multiple cryptocurrency projects based on their technological prowess, viability and innovation potential.

At the top of the rubric of crypto projects was Ethereum, a second-generation blockchain renowned for its smart contract capabilities. Ethereum achieved an impressive technology evaluation index of 129.4. Accordingly, it solidified its position as the leading blockchain. Those who follow him closely are altcoin Steem Chain, Lisk, NEO and altcoin Komodo. Surprisingly, Bitcoin, which has been the focus of the industry for a long time, modestly ranked 13th.

Market challenges for legacy top-line projects

The comprehensive assessment takes into account key aspects such as basic technical level, application level and innovation capability when ranking projects. However, it turns out that many of these projects are struggling to withstand the ups and downs of the crypto market. Projects listed by the Chinese Ministry of Truth five years ago continue to be traded on the market. Most suffered a significant drop in their billion-dollar market share.

For example, the altcoin Steem Chain, which closely follows Ethereum in the ranking. Accordingly, it had a market capitalization of over $1.5 billion in January 2018. Unfortunately, the market cap of the cryptocurrency currently hovers around $75 million. On the other hand, it ranks 300th among the most important crypto projects. Similarly, Lisk and Komodo coins have a market capitalization of well below $100 million. However, altcoin Ethereum retained its top spot with a market cap of $228 billion.
